Hanukkah is a time for light, love, and thoughtful gifts. If you’re looking for the perfect present for your boyfriend, look no further than these creative ideas that blend tradition with a personal touch.
1. Personalized Hanukkah Gift Basket
Create a gift basket filled with his favorite snacks and a few Hanukkah-themed treats. Add a personal note or photo for a special touch—it’s a simple way to show how well you know him.
2. Artisan Olive Oil Set
Gift him an artisan olive oil set to elevate his cooking game, a nod to the miracle of the oil during Hanukkah. Pair it with a recipe card for a romantic night of cooking together.
3. Festive Candle Set
A set of festive candles in Hanukkah colors can brighten up his space and add to the holiday spirit.
4. Personalized Hanukkah Card
Craft a personalized Hanukkah card with a heartfelt message. Sometimes, the simplest gestures are the most meaningful.
5. Custom Printed Socks
Add some fun to his wardrobe with custom printed socks featuring Hanukkah motifs. They’re playful and keep his toes warm!
6. Gourmet Hot Chocolate Set
Indulge his sweet tooth with a gourmet hot chocolate set. Perfect for sipping while watching the candles flicker.
7. DIY Hanukkah Candle Kit
Gift a DIY candle-making kit for a hands-on experience. Making candles together is both creative and symbolic of the holiday.
8. Monogrammed Fleece Blanket
A monogrammed fleece blanket adds a personal touch to a practical gift. It’s perfect for cozy movie nights during the festival of lights.
9. Customized Photo Frame
Capture a special memory in a customized photo frame. It’s a constant reminder of your cherished moments together.
10. Surprise Experience Gift
Plan a surprise experience gift like a day trip or concert tickets. Sometimes the best gifts aren’t things but memories.
11. Jewish Heritage Book
A book on Jewish heritage or a collection of Yiddish stories can be a thoughtful gift that sparks conversation and connection.
12. Handcrafted Jewelry
Surprise him with handcrafted jewelry that reflects his style and heritage. It’s a unique way to show your appreciation.
13. Themed Movie Night Kit
Create a themed movie night kit with classic films and snacks for a cozy evening in. It’s a perfect way to unwind together.
14. Hanukkah Cocktail Set
For the mixology enthusiast, a Hanukkah cocktail set featuring themed drink recipes can make the holiday extra spirited.
15. Virtual Cooking Class
Sign up for a virtual cooking class together to learn how to make traditional Hanukkah dishes. It’s a fun way to bond over new skills.
16. Handmade Pottery
Gift him handmade pottery like a mug or bowl for a unique and artisanal touch to his daily routine.
17. Custom Engraved Menorah
Surprise him with a custom engraved menorah that he can cherish for years. It’s both a meaningful and stylish addition to his home decor.
